Output 69db15520de2aaa80a7fd4d5ab53ca8468b40945dcb0369040eb7839dee63ba9:139

value
50342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abaa114df0bdb26eeca37a8d4411f42bacf529bb OP_EQUAL
address
3HLhCrHAeTT3DZdXUmWCJTMKmoPkrs6ZgN
transaction
69db15520de2aaa80a7fd4d5ab53ca8468b40945dcb0369040eb7839dee63ba9
confirmations
155489
spent
true